    Have had one for about almost a year now and have been around expensive mics in recording studios since the 70's. IMHO, the 440 would be a great mic at any price point. Simple; no bells and whistles; single pattern without switches, pads, roll-offs, etc. Hence the "Pure." A great price for the sound is the best way to put it. Very quiet, clear and detailed.     If a simple employee from AKG creates his own company and works with other staff, it does not mean that he becomes the new AKG or that he continues and is the one who carries on the tradition of the company that I just defended. I know the story of Roman Perschon, told by him himself, and he stated that he left AKG precisely because he was not satisfied with the sound philosophy of the AKG company and the traditional way of manufacturing microphones. In addition, Roman Perschon is single and left the AKG company, in which he no longer believed. Instead, the engineers and all the other employees of AKG bought all the production equipment owned by AKG and founded the company Austrian Audio. This wonderful team produces microphones with the same machines and with the same people and engineers at AKG. Roman Perschon produces his microphones in Clina with other equipment and not even one employee from the old AKG accompanied him to China to work on his project. Under these conditions, I ask the basic question, if I feel good. What is the next AKG? The new company founded by Roman Perschon that works with the Chinese or Austrian Audio that produces in Vienna with the same equipment bought from AKG and with the entire team of AKG employees?
